tribal-memory/tribal
Self-hosted semantic memory server, served over MCP, for an engineering team's tribal knowledge: the tacit decisions and hard-won reasoning behind the code, captured once and kept queryable for the team and the agents they work with. Postgres-backed (pgvector).
Installation
Build from source (Rust)
git clone https://github.com/tribal-memory/tribal.git
cd tribal
cargo build --releaseRelated in Knowledge & Memory
